Romans 15:13-14 is about Paul expressing his hope and encouragement for the Roman believers to be filled with joy, peace, and hope through the power of the Holy Spirit, and commending them for their ability to instruct one another from the goodness of their hearts.
13 May the God of hope fill you with all joy and peace in believing, so that by the power of the Holy Spirit you may abound in hope.
14 I myself am satisfied about you, my brothers, that you yourselves are full of goodness, filled with all knowledge and able to instruct one another.

Setting the Scene for Romans 15:13-14
In Romans chapter 15, the apostle Paul is writing to the Christians in Rome, expressing his desire to visit them and share the gospel. As he prepares to conclude his letter, he mentions his hope that God, who gives hope and peace, will fill the believers with joy and peace as they trust in Him. Paul also expresses his confidence in the Roman Christians, commending them for their goodness and knowledge, and encouraging them to instruct and counsel one another.

Understanding what Romans 15:13-14 really means
Introduction
In the Book of Romans, the apostle Paul addresses the Christian community in Rome, offering theological insights and practical guidance. As Paul concludes his letter, he imparts words of encouragement and exhortation to the believers in Rome, including the verses found in Romans 15:13-14.
Verse Breakdown
“May the God of hope fill you with all joy and peace as you trust in him.” Here, God is portrayed as the ultimate source of hope, joy, and peace. Trusting in Him not only brings emotional fulfillment but also cultivates a sense of serenity amidst life’s challenges. This message resonates with other biblical passages like Philippians 4:7 and Isaiah 26:3, emphasizing the profound peace that comes from trusting in God. In a world marked by turmoil and uncertainty, placing our trust in God becomes the anchor for our souls.
“So that you may overflow with hope by the power of the Holy Spirit.” The Holy Spirit plays a pivotal role in empowering believers to possess a hope that transcends mere optimism. Drawing parallels with Acts 1:8 and Galatians 5:22, we see that the Holy Spirit infuses believers with love, joy, and peace, enabling them to navigate life’s challenges with unwavering hope. This hope, rooted in the unchanging character of God, sustains us even in the darkest of times.
“I myself am convinced, my brothers and sisters, that you yourselves are full of goodness, filled with knowledge and competent to instruct one another.” Paul expresses his confidence in the spiritual maturity of the Roman Christians, highlighting their capacity to support and teach one another. This sentiment echoes similar calls to community found in Colossians 3:16 and Hebrews 10:24-25, emphasizing the mutual edification and encouragement that believers are called to provide. In a culture that often prioritizes individualism, this reminder of communal support is a vital aspect of the Christian journey.
